Scottish Scientists Invent "Sonic Screwdriver"

Part Tricorder and part lock-pick, Dr. Who’s famous all-in-one device could handle any crisis — save deadlock seals. Now, researchers from Dundee University have replicated at least some of the screwdriver’s functionality with a machine capable of lifting and turning suspended objects.
